Amish Use Vehicles To Herd Deer Near State Route 715Coshocton County OH

audio iconOther Crimes
OH-715 & Co Rd 20, Newcastle Township, OH 43844

Law enforcement responded to reports of Amish individuals using four wheelers to herd deer near State Route 715 and County Road 20, which may violate wildlife regulations. Officers are coordinating with a park ranger to address the issue.
